How do you delete a bookmark folder

Right-click on bookmark has no active delete option. How can you delete a bookmark folder?

What operating system are you on and where are you clicking? I just went to double check with my Windows 10 and when I right-click on a bookmark, it comes up with a delete option. The same with folders. The only folders I can’t delete is the primary Bookmarks Folder, as it always has to remain.

And to show, I see it also in my Bookmarks Manager. So if you can help to clarify what device you’re using and what you’re (not) seeing, it can help us. Oh, and might be beneficial to let us know what version of Brave you’re using.

I am using Windows 10 and for folders the delete button is inactive.

Ah, ok. Those two main folders can’t be deleted to my knowledge. You can kind of think of it like saying you want to delete your C drive on your computer. They are the “primary” folders. I can’t remember if “Others” existed right away or if it gets created when you import things over. Then I know if you Sync and have a mobile device, it will also create Mobile folder.
